Binance User Data Linked to Arrest of Ukrainian Donor
Binance, one of the world's largest cryptocurrency exchanges, has been at the center of controversy after it emerged that the platform handed over user data to Russia, which led to a Ukrainian donor's arrest.
The incident raises questions about the exchange's handling of sensitive information and its compliance with international laws. According to reports, Binance shared data with Russian authorities in July 2022, following a request under the Mutual Legal Assistance Treaty (MLAT).
The arrested individual is believed to be a Ukrainian donor who had provided financial support to anti-Kremlin forces in Ukraine.
